Man Released After 18 Years Without Trial in Rivers State

In a major step toward tackling prolonged detentions and prison overcrowding, the Chief Judge of Rivers State, Justice Simeon Amadi, on Thursday launched the state’s jail delivery exercise by releasing 21 inmates from the Port Harcourt Correctional Centre—including a man who spent 18 years in custody without trial.
